The relative risk of miscarriage and premature birth caused by uterine septate ranges from 5% to 95%. If the septate uterus does not affect fertility, surgical treatment is not required, but those who have had habitual miscarriages in the past may consider surgical treatment. Before the advent of hysteroscopic surgery, the surgical method for treating symptomatic uterine septum was to remove the septum tissue vaginally or abdominally. The former was difficult to operate and blind, resulting in incomplete removal of the septum and poor results; abdominal surgery was to make a transverse incision at the fundus of the uterus to shear the septum, or to make a median incision in the uterine body to trim the uterine septum and reconstruct the uterine muscle wall.

No matter which of the above methods is used, it will leave scars on the uterus and abdominal wall, cause great trauma, and take a long time to recover. It may even cause uterine adhesions, which will have a certain impact on future pregnancies. In addition, contraception will be required for several years before pregnancy, and cesarean section will be required in most cases.
